Chrysoberyl Crystal Specimen, Sri Lanka perspex Swipe to see a videoChrysoberyl is an exceptionally hard gemstone composed of beryllium aluminium oxide, making it the third hardest natural gemstone. The name derives from Greek words meaning "golden" and "beryl," though it is scientifically distinct from the beryl family.
